One of the many special parts of my role is having the opportunity to spend time with someone before they pass, and it’s a true privilege to hear their story straight from their hearts.
I’ve mentioned previously about forging strong bonds with the family of those who have passed, and having spent time with someone who is on end of life care and getting to know that person while gaining their trust and forging a bond brings an added emotion when I hear of their passing.

I’ll never forget those times, sitting by their bedside, or in their home. I’ll always remember the sound of their voice, but most of all their courage to speak about the inevitable.

It’s a truly humbling and touching experience.

It’s been a busy week, visiting families for upcoming services and writing their loved ones tributes.
I will never get used to the humbling feeling of these families welcoming me in to their home then sharing their loved one and their life with me.
I’m met with many warm, friendly and lovely people who are going through one of the worst times of their life but they show interest in my role, my life and it doesn’t take long for me to feel like I’ve become part of their family.
Some may say that I shouldn’t get attached, but that’s what forms the bond where people feel comfortable to put their trust in me.
I absolutely “love” this role. Of course, it’s hard at times, it’s not 9-5 and it’s emotional but I have my own friends and family to distract me from that and I count myself very lucky to have such a great, loving network. 🌻
